Understanding the Importance of SEO-Friendly Headlines
Headlines serve as the first impression of your content. They help search engines understand what your article is about and determine its relevance to users’ queries. An optimized headline can significantly boost your content’s visibility in search results, leading to higher click-through rates.
Key Elements of Effective Headlines
- Keyword Placement: Incorporate relevant keywords naturally to improve searchability.
- Clarity: Clearly convey the main idea of the article.
- Engagement: Use compelling language that sparks curiosity or offers value.
- Conciseness: Keep headlines concise, ideally under 70 characters.
Strategies for Crafting SEO-Friendly Headlines
1. Use Targeted Keywords
Research relevant keywords that your target audience is searching for. Place these keywords at the beginning of your headline when possible to maximize SEO impact.
2. Focus on Benefits and Value
Highlight what readers will gain from your content. Phrases like “How to,” “Tips for,” or “Strategies to” can increase clickability by promising practical value.
3. Create Curiosity and Urgency
Encourage clicks by teasing information or emphasizing urgency. Words like “Secrets,” “Essential,” or “Now” can motivate users to act quickly.
